Rock ‘n Roll Car Show at The Pavilions Moves to Cold Beers & Cheeseburgers
By Staff | April 26, 2025

The long-celebrated Rock ‘n Roll Car Show at The Pavilions at Talking Stick in Scottsdale is moving four miles up the road to Cold Beers & Cheeseburgers at Pima Crossing at 8624 E. Shea Blvd., Scottsdale, AZ 85260 (corner of 101 Pima Freeway and Shea Boulevard) for the summer.
The first day of the new location will be Sat., May 17 and it will take place there every Saturday from 5 to 8 p.m. through Sept. 27.
Cold Beers & Cheeseburgers already hosts a first Tuesday of the month car show at its Pima Crossing location and at its Gilbert Town Square location, 1026 S Gilbert Rd, Gilbert, Ariz. 85296, with the next one happening Tues., May 6. Gilbert will continue the first Tuesday tradition while Pima Crossing in Scottsdale will segue to every Saturday evening this summer.
“We’re beer and burger fans, of course, and we’re also big car fans! People who know me know I’m a huge enthusiast, and so I’m particularly delighted to host the Rock ‘n Roll Car Show at our Pima Crossing location all summer long,” says S. Barrett Rinzler, founder & CEO, Square One Concepts, the restaurant group of Cold Beers & Cheeseburgers.
Car owners will receive a courtesy Cold Beers & Cheeseburgers gift card just for participating.
